Transaction 8656e33f400f64a37b1dbae7ac0e3edd34790da2e136dbfadcf7f9067b9f8649
1 Input
1 Output
-
8656e33f400f64a37b1dbae7ac0e3edd34790da2e136dbfadcf7f9067b9f8649:0
- value
- 503518
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d38feed8bb63691bfb1b778ab5da977e2bdc7fb
- address
- bc1qf5u0amvtkcmfr0a3kau2khdfwl3tm3lmqyrd6q